It's time to renew the treaty between Araluen and Skandia. But news from the north has Ranger Commandant Gilan and Queen Cassandra on edge about what might happen at the upcoming meeting.

Deciding to be safe rather than sorry, they enlist the help of retired Ranger Halt and Redmont Fief's very own Ranger Will, the man who had played such a crucial role in creating the treaty to begin with that his last name derives from the document. On their journey, they add an unexpected member to their group before sailing to Skandia.

But once they arrive, things don't go exactly as planned. Can the treaty be renewed? And, if it can, what will it cost?
